Harding Women's Basketball Falls on Late 3-Pointer at Cameron

LAWTON, Okla. – Caitlin Clancy hit the game-winning 3-pointer from the left corner with 0:04 seconds remaining to give Cameron a 66-65 victory over Harding on Friday. It was the first time the Lady Bisons had trailed in the game since there were four minutes left in the first quarter.

Harding sophomore Sydney Layrock scored a career-high 28 points and led the Lady Bisons with 11 rebounds for her third career double-double. Junior Correy Moyer added 15 points, senior A'ndi Haney added 11 points and sophomore Falan Miller had five points and 10 rebounds.

Brittany Hill led Cameron, a member of the NCAA Division II Lone Star Conference, with 12 points.

RECORDS
The game was the season opener for both teams. Harding fell to 0-1, and Cameron is 1-0.

FIRST QUARTER HIGHLIGHTS
Harding led 17-10 after the first quarter with Moyer leading the Lady Bisons with seven points in the quarter. Haney had six points. Harding shot 40 percent in the quarter and held Cameron to 31 percent.

SECOND QUARTER HIGHLIGHTS
The Lady Bisons led 33-26 at halftime. Layrock scored nine points in the quarter and made 5-of-6 free throws. Cameron scored nine of its 16 points in the quarter from the free-throw line, shooting only 23 percent from the field.

THIRD QUARTER HIGHLIGHTS
The Lady Bisons led 49-43 after the third quarter. Layrock had 11 points and five rebounds in the quarter. She was 3-of-3 from 3-point range, and four of Harding's six field goals in the quarter were 3-pointers. Cameron outscored Harding 6-0 off turnovers in the quarter.

FOURTH QUARTER HIGHLIGHTS
Cameron outscored Harding 23-16 in the quarter with 18 of its 23 points coming from non-starters. The Aggies shot 53 percent. Layrock scored seven points in the quarter for the Lady Bisons. Harding took its largest lead of the game at 11 points with 7:31 left.

TEAM STATS
Harding shot 50 percent from 3-point range, connecting on 8-of-16.

Cameron shot only 27 percent in the first half, but shot 44 percent in the second half.

Cameron led Harding 28-24 in the paint, but the Lady Bisons held a 14-10 lead off turnovers.

Cameron had 38 points from non-starters.

INDIVIDUAL STATS
Sydney Layrock's 28 points marked her first career 20-point game. Her previous career high was 18 points last season against Henderson State. She also had more than 10 rebounds for the third time.

Falan Miller's 10 rebounds broke her previous career high of five, set twice last season.

Correy Moyer scored 15 points, her 11th game with 10 or more points for the Lady Bisons
